Output 669b64a56391918e75fb88b909bbd017fe2ce9659142beaf9590eaec9d8fbf27:14

value
266502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7509f0d5ed54f48e279b25b431e023af2ac750e2 OP_EQUAL
address
3CMrtgeKHMQw2cEoKzvwbvxDsyQo76uh6p
transaction
669b64a56391918e75fb88b909bbd017fe2ce9659142beaf9590eaec9d8fbf27
spent
true